About This Scholarship

The University of Miami’s Isaac Bashevis Singer Scholarship is a scholarship program that provides financial assistance to students who are pursuing a degree in the fields of creative writing or Jewish studies. The scholarship is named after the Nobel Prize-winning author Isaac Bashevis Singer, who taught at the University of Miami for many years.

The scholarship is awarded to undergraduate or graduate students who have demonstrated academic excellence and a strong interest in creative writing or Jewish studies. Recipients of the scholarship receive financial aid that can be used to cover tuition fees, textbooks, and other educational expenses.

Eligibility Criteria For University of Miami Isaac Bashevis Singer Scholarship

The Isaac Bashevis Singer Scholarship at the University of Miami is a merit-based scholarship program that is awarded to incoming undergraduate students who have demonstrated exceptional talent and accomplishment in creative writing, music, or visual arts. The scholarship is named after the Nobel Prize-winning writer Isaac Bashevis Singer, who taught at the University of Miami for many years.

  • To be eligible for the Isaac Bashevis Singer Scholarship, students must have applied for admission to the University of Miami and be accepted as a major in the Department of English, the Frost School of Music, or the Department of Art and Art History.
  •  Applicants must also submit a portfolio of their creative work, which will be reviewed by a committee of faculty members in the relevant department.

The scholarship is awarded based on the quality and potential of the applicant’s creative work, as demonstrated in their portfolio. While there are no specific GPA or test score requirements, successful candidates typically have a strong academic record and demonstrate exceptional talent and potential in their chosen artistic discipline.
